Web14 de abr. de 2024 · Cancel culture doesn’t just affect the canceled and the cancelers. It can also wreak havoc on onlookers’ mental health. After seeing so many people being canceled, some bystanders are plagued with fear. They become overwhelmed with anxiety that people will turn on them if they fully express themselves. Socialization is the process through which people are taught to be proficient members of a society.
